易语言是一种专为中国人设计的编程语言,它以简化的语法和中文命令名称为特点,降低了编程的门槛,尤其适合初学者。在这个“易语言导入EXCEL到EDB数据库源码”的项目中,我们主要讨论的是如何利用易语言来处理数据导入的操作,特别是将Excel数据导入到EDB(EasyDatabase,易语言自有的数据库格式)数据库。
我们需要理解易语言中的外部数据库组件。这是易语言提供的一种与数据库交互的工具,它可以连接多种类型的数据库,如MySQL、SQL Server、Oracle等,以及自定义的EDB数据库。通过这个组件,开发者可以执行SQL语句,进行数据的读取、写入和更新操作。
在描述中提到的程序,其核心功能是将Excel文件的数据导入到EDB数据库中。Excel文件通常用于存储和处理表格数据,而EDB数据库则用于长期存储和管理这些数据。这个过程通常包括以下步骤:
1. **文件打开与读取**:程序首先需要打开指定的Excel文件,这通常涉及到对文件路径的操作和文件流的处理。易语言提供了“文件”系列命令来完成这部分工作。
2. **数据解析**:读取Excel文件内容后,程序需要解析数据,这可能需要用到易语言的字符串处理和数组操作命令。Excel数据通常以行和列的形式存在,解析时要将其转换为易于处理的数据结构。
3. **连接数据库**:建立到EDB数据库的连接,这需要使用外部数据库组件。需要设置正确的数据库路径、用户名和密码,然后通过“连接数据库”命令建立连接。
4. **创建表结构**:如果目标数据库中尚未存在对应表,程序需要先创建表结构,根据Excel文件的列名确定字段名称和类型。
5. **数据导入**:有了数据和连接,就可以使用SQL插入语句将数据一行一行地写入数据库。易语言的外部数据库组件提供了执行SQL语句的方法。
6. **关闭连接**:为了释放资源和确保数据完整性,程序应关闭与数据库的连接。
在标签中提到的“SanYe”,可能是该源码的作者或者是一个特定的易语言开发社区,这可能意味着你可以在那里找到更多关于易语言编程的资源和帮助。
至于压缩包中的"content.txt"文件,通常它可能包含了程序的详细说明、使用指南或者是源代码的注释。如果你想要深入理解这个源码的工作原理,阅读这个文本文件会是非常有帮助的。
这个项目展示了易语言在数据处理和数据库操作上的应用,对于学习易语言和数据库管理的初学者来说,是一个很好的实践案例。通过实际操作和研究源码,可以加深对易语言以及数据库操作的理解。